VPN的基本概念
虚拟专用网络(Virtual Private Network,简称VPN)是一种通过公共网络(如互联网)建立加密通道的技术,使远程用户或分支机构能够安全地访问企业内部网络资源,VPN的核心功能包括数据加密、身份认证和隧道技术,确保通信的私密性和安全性。
1 VPN的主要类型
- 远程访问VPN:适用于个人用户或移动办公人员,如员工通过VPN连接到公司内网。
- 站点到站点VPN:用于连接不同地理位置的局域网(LAN),如企业分支机构之间的通信。
- SSL VPN:基于Web浏览器的VPN,无需安装专用客户端,适合临时访问。
- IPSec VPN:提供更高安全性的VPN协议,常用于企业级网络。
VPN的连接方式
1 基于客户端的VPN连接
大多数企业VPN采用客户端软件(如Cisco AnyConnect、OpenVPN、FortiClient等),用户需安装并配置VPN客户端后才能连接,以下是典型的连接步骤:
- 下载并安装VPN客户端:从企业IT部门或VPN提供商获取客户端软件。
- 配置VPN参数:
- 输入VPN服务器地址(如
vpn.example.com或IP地址)。 - 选择认证方式(用户名/密码、证书、双因素认证等)。
- 输入VPN服务器地址(如
- 建立连接:
- 启动客户端,输入凭据,点击“连接”。
- 成功连接后,客户端会显示加密状态和分配的IP地址。
2 操作系统内置VPN功能
Windows、macOS和Linux均支持原生VPN配置,无需额外软件:
- Windows:
- 进入“设置” > “网络和Internet” > “VPN” > “添加VPN连接”。
- 填写服务器信息,选择协议(如PPTP、L2TP/IPSec、IKEv2等)。
- 输入用户名和密码,点击“连接”。
- macOS:
- 打开“系统偏好设置” > “网络” > 点击“+”添加VPN连接。
- 选择协议(如IPSec、IKEv2),填写服务器地址和账户信息。
- 点击“连接”完成配置。
3 移动设备VPN连接
Android和iOS设备也支持VPN:
- Android:
- 进入“设置” > “网络和Internet” > “VPN” > “添加VPN”。
- 填写名称、类型(如PPTP、L2TP/IPSec)、服务器地址和认证信息。
- iOS:
- 进入“设置” > “通用” > “VPN” > “添加VPN配置”。
- 选择协议(如IPSec、IKEv2),输入服务器和账户信息。
VPN的协议与加密技术
1 常见VPN协议
- PPTP(点对点隧道协议):速度快但安全性低,已逐渐淘汰。
- L2TP/IPSec:结合L2TP的隧道技术和IPSec的加密,安全性较高。
- OpenVPN:开源协议,支持高强度加密,配置灵活。
- IKEv2/IPSec:适用于移动设备,支持网络切换时自动重连。
- WireGuard:新兴协议,性能优越,配置简单。
2 加密技术
VPN使用多种加密算法保障数据安全:
- 对称加密:如AES-256,用于加密数据流。
- 非对称加密:如RSA,用于密钥交换。
- 哈希算法:如SHA-256,用于数据完整性验证。
VPN连接的常见问题与解决方案
1 连接失败的可能原因
- 服务器地址错误:检查VPN服务器是否输入正确。
- 防火墙/路由器拦截:确保VPN端口(如UDP 500、4500)未被封锁。
- 认证失败:确认用户名、密码或证书有效。
- 协议不匹配:客户端和服务端需使用相同协议。
2 优化VPN连接速度
- 选择距离较近的VPN服务器。
- 更换协议(如从L2TP/IPSec切换到WireGuard)。
- 关闭不必要的后台应用,减少带宽占用。
企业VPN的最佳实践
1 安全策略
- 强制使用多因素认证(MFA)。
- 定期更新VPN服务器和客户端软件。
- 限制VPN访问权限,仅允许必要用户接入。
2 日志与监控
- 记录VPN登录日志,检测异常行为。
- 使用网络监控工具(如Wireshark)分析VPN流量。
未来发展趋势
- 零信任网络(ZTNA):逐步替代传统VPN,提供更细粒度的访问控制。
- 云VPN服务:如AWS Client VPN、Azure VPN Gateway,降低企业自建成本。
- AI驱动的安全分析:实时检测VPN流量中的威胁行为。
VPN连接是保障远程办公和网络安全的关键技术,用户需根据需求选择合适的协议和配置方式,同时企业应加强VPN的安全管理,以应对日益复杂的网络威胁,通过本文的详细指南,无论是个人用户还是IT管理员,都能更高效地部署和使用VPN。








